Monetization Strategies for Video Games
Premium vs. Free-to-Play Models
Premium and free-to-play models represent distinct monetization strategies in gaming. Premium games require upfront payment, ensuring immediate revenue. He notes that this model often attracts dedicated players. They are willing to invest in quality experiences.
In contrast, free-to-play games generate revenue through in-game purchases. This approach can reach a broader audience. He believes that successful free-to-play games balance monetization with player satisfaction. It’s a delicate equilibrium.
Additionally, both models can coexist within the same franchise. This strategy allows developers to maximize revenue streams. He asserts that understanding player preferences is crucial for choosing the right model. This insight drives financial success.

Case Studies of Community-Driven Success
Case studies of community-driven success highlight the power of player feedback. For instance, “No Man’s Sky” transformed its reputation through community engagement. He notes that developers actively listened to player concerns. This responsiveness led to significant game improvements.
Additionally, “Destiny 2” utilized player input for content updates. He believes that this approach fosters loyalty and trust. Players feel valued when their opinions matter. It enhances community bonds.
Moreover, “Among Us” gained popularity through organic community support. He asserts that word-of-mouth promotion can drive sales. Engaged communities can significantly impact a game’s success. This is a strategic advantage.
